2. Aisling. This is the Irish name for Ashley and is pronounced ASH-lyeen with a soft n sound. It's a relatively common Irish baby girls' name that means "dream" or "vision.". 3. Bridget. Bridget was a very popular Irish American name for girls in the 1970s; it's the anglicized version of the old Irish name Brighid.

One of our favorite Irish girl names as it is a great example of ancient celtic female names around still. Sorcha - (SOO-ruh-ka or SOHR-e-khuh) Old Irish=sorchae "bright, radiant." Popular from the Middle Ages to present and a particularly popular Irish girl names in the 1800s.

While names like Erin, Colleen and Shannon are often thought of as Irish names, they are rarely encountered in Ireland and are not traditional names. They became popular instead in places to which Irish people emigrated

11. Saoirse - Pronounced 'Sir-Sha'. This beautiful and meaningful Irish name means freedom. This stunning name became popular as a girls name in Ireland during the early 1920's. This could be a result of the times as freedom was foremost on the minds of the Irish people during the War of Independence.

Ita is an Irish girl's name that means "thirst for knowledge." It is derived from the Old Irish word "íde," which represents a strong desire for learning and intellectual curiosity. Róisín. Floral, delicate and pretty, Róisín is a lovely and traditional Irish name for a girl. It is made from the Gaelic elements "róis," meaning "rose," and "Nín," meaning "little.". Together, of course, this makes the delightfully sweet meaning of "little rose," an adorable variation on the popular flowery name.

Cara. Cara is a short and simple Irish name for a girl that is pronounced exactly how you think it would be. Cara, pronounced 'kara', means 'friend'.
